Full Details of Job Post

Overview: We are seeking a detail-oriented and experienced Grant Revenue Accountant to manage and oversee the financial aspects of grant funding, including revenue recognition, reporting, and compliance with grant agreements. The ideal candidate will have a solid background in non-profit or governmental accounting, with a focus on grant management, revenue recognition, and financial reporting. The Grant Revenue Accountant will play a critical role in ensuring that all grant funds are properly tracked, recorded, and reported in compliance with funder requirements and organizational policies.
Responsibilities:
Grant Revenue Recognition:
Accurately record and recognize grant revenue in accordance with GAAP and donor restrictions.
Ensure proper tracking of restricted and unrestricted grant funds, and release restrictions as requirements are met.
Coordinate with program and development teams to ensure that grant funding is recorded and allocated appropriately.
Grant Management & Compliance:
Ensure compliance with all grant agreements and funding guidelines, including timely financial reporting, proper allocation of expenses, and adherence to spending restrictions.
Review grant agreements to understand financial requirements, such as allowable costs and reporting deadlines.
Monitor spending on grant-funded programs to ensure adherence to grant budgets and funder requirements.
Financial Reporting:
Prepare monthly, quarterly, and annual financial reports for grant-funded programs, providing clear and accurate financial information to internal stakeholders and external funders.
Reconcile grant revenue accounts and ensure accuracy in financial reporting.
Assist in the preparation of annual audits, ensuring compliance with grant agreements and government regulations (such as the Single Audit for federal grants).
Budgeting & Forecasting:
Work closely with program managers to develop grant budgets and ensure alignment with program goals and funding requirements.
Provide financial projections and forecasts for grant-funded programs and assist with budget revisions as necessary.
Monitor cash flow and revenue recognition timelines for multi-year grants.
Grant Tracking & Documentation:
Maintain detailed records of all grant agreements, amendments, and financial transactions related to grant funding.
Track and document grant revenue and expenditures, ensuring clear audit trails for all transactions.
Support the preparation of grant reimbursement requests, invoices, and cash drawdowns, ensuring timely submission to funders.
Internal Controls & Process Improvement:
Develop and maintain internal controls related to grant revenue recognition, ensuring compliance with organizational policies and funder requirements.
Identify opportunities to improve financial systems and processes related to grant revenue management.
Collaboration & Communication:
Collaborate with the development and program teams to provide financial insights and support for grant proposals, applications, and reporting.
Serve as the primary point of contact for program and finance teams regarding grant financial matters.
Qualifications:
Bachelor’s degree in Accounting, Finance, or a related field.
3+ years of accounting experience, with a focus on grant management, revenue recognition, and financial reporting in a non-profit, governmental, or educational organization.
Strong knowledge of GAAP, especially in relation to revenue recognition for grants and restricted funds.
Experience with accounting software (e.g., QuickBooks, Sage Intacct) and grant management systems.
Excellent attention to detail and the ability to manage multiple tasks and deadlines.
Strong analytical skills and the ability to translate financial data into actionable insights.
Excellent communication skills, both written and verbal, and the ability to collaborate with non-financial stakeholders.
Familiarity with federal grant regulations, including the Uniform Guidance (2 CFR Part 200), is a plus.
